GB/T 13284-2025 is the English-translated version of 核电厂安全系统设计准则.

GB/T 13284-2025 is the Chinese national standard on design criteria of safety systems in nuclear power plants, in the field of energy and heat transfer engineering. The /T suffix marks it as a recommended standard: it is not compulsory by itself, but it becomes binding as soon as a contract, a tender or a customer specification calls it up - which in practice is how most foreign buyers meet it. It was issued on 25 April 2025 by the State Administration for Market Regulation; Standardization Administration of China, and has been in force since 1 November 2025. Classification: ICS 27.120.20, CCS F83. Foreword

This document is in accordance with the provisions of GB/T 1.1-2020 "Guidelines for standardization work Part

1.Structure and drafting rules for standardization documents" Drafting. This document replaces GB/T 13284.1-2008 "Nuclear power plant safety system Part

1.Design criteria" and GB/T 13284.1- Compared with.2008, in addition to structural adjustments and editorial changes, the main technical changes are as follows:

--- Changed the definition of terms (see Chapter 3, Chapter 3 of the.2008 edition);

--- Deleted the contents of set value and safe state limit (see

4.4.4 of the.2008 edition);

--- Changed the safety classification of the interface equipment of the safety system (see 5.7.4.2,

5.6.3.1 of the.2008 edition);

--- Changed the content of common cause failure (see 5.17,

5.16 of the.2008 edition);

--- The manual control method has been changed (see 6.3,

6.2 of the.2008 edition);

--- Added maintenance bypass requirements (see 6.8). Please note that some of the contents of this document may involve patents. The issuing organization of this document does not assume the responsibility for identifying patents. This document was proposed and coordinated by the National Technical Committee for Standardization of Nuclear Instruments (SAC/TC30). This document was drafted by: Nuclear Industry Standardization Institute, Beijing Guangli Nuclear System Engineering Co., Ltd., and China Nuclear Power Research and Design Institute. The main drafters of this document are. Liang Xueyuan, Jiao Liling, Wang Xiaoyan, Du Jian, Pei Hongwei, Wu Fangjie, Ma Jianxin, Huang Junlong, Liu Chunming, Liu Hongchun, Chen Peng and He Liang. The previous versions of this document and the documents it replaces are as follows:

--- First issued as GB 13284-1991 in.1991 and first revised in.1998;

This document specifies the minimum functional and design requirements for the power source, instrumentation and control parts of the nuclear power plant safety system. This document applies to the design of those systems required to prevent or mitigate the consequences of design basis events and to protect public health and safety. It is used as a reference for the design of all safety-related systems, structures and equipment required to protect the safety of the entire nuclear power plant.

3 Terms and definitions

The following terms and definitions apply to this document.

3.1 Safety function To ensure that nuclear facilities or activities can prevent and mitigate the radioactive consequences of normal operation of nuclear power plants, anticipated transient operation and accident conditions. Specific functions that must be completed to ensure nuclear safety. [Source: GB/T 41143-2021, 3.16, modified]

3.2 Safety systemsafety system Safety factors used to ensure safe shutdown of the reactor, remove residual heat from the core, or limit the consequences of anticipated operational events and design basis events. Need system.

3.3 Safety class safetyclass Level 1E A safety level for electrical equipment and systems in nuclear power plants. Note

1.These equipment and systems are necessary to complete reactor emergency shutdown, containment isolation, core cooling, and heat removal from the containment and reactor.
